Pb addition makes easier to form the high Tc phase in the BSCCO system. However, Pb easily vaporized at high temperature. A controlled Pb potential method has been applied to grow the high Tc phase in films. Initially, films are deposited on cleaved MgO substrates using an rf magnetron sputtering system. These amorphous as-deposited films are heat treated in a sealed gold capsule along with a large pellet of Pb-added BSCCO. Details of the process and characterization of the films have been reported elsewhere (1). Films trated for 0.5h at 850° C contain mainly the low Tc phase with a small amount of the high Tc phase. Hawever, films treated for 3h at 850°C consist mainly of the high Tc phase. This film is superconductive with a Tc(zero) of 106K. The Pb/Bi ratio of the films, analysed by SEM- EDS, are 0.12 and 0.18 for heat tratment times of 0.5 and 3h, respectively. The present study investigates the modulated structures of these films using HREM.

   on this research is to study the effect of nickel oxide substitution on the pure phases superconductor Tl0.5Pb0.5Ba2Can-1Cun-xNixO2n+3-δ (n=3) where x=(0,0.2,0.4,0.6,0.8.and 1.0). The specimens in this work were prepared with used  procedure of solid state reaction with sintering temperature 8500C for 24 h .we used technical (4-prob)to calculated and the critical temperature Tc . The results of the XRD diffraction analysis showed that the structure for pure and doped phases was tetragonal with phases high-Tc phase (1223),(1212) and low-Tc phase (1202)  and add to the presence of some impure phase. It was noted the value a=b,c  the parameter of  the lattice increment  with the increment of Ni content. The increment of (NiO) concentration effects electrical resistivity, dielectric constant and the hardness.
